Crystal, Jennifer 1973–

(Jennifer Crystal Foley)

PERSONAL

Born January 26, 1973, in Los Angeles, CA; daughter of Billy (an actor, director, producer, and comedian) and Janice Crystal; married Michael Foley (a production manager), September, 2000. Education: Northwestern University, graduated, 1994.

Addresses:

Agent—Paul Rosicker, Gersh Agency, 232 North Canon Dr., Beverly Hills, CA 90210.

Career:

Actress. Appeared in a television commercial for peanut butter. Previously worked as a waitress at Kate Mantilini, Beverly Hills, CA.

Awards, Honors:

Young Artist Award nomination, best young actress costarring in an off-primetime or cable series, 1992, for Sessions.

CREDITS

Film Appearances:

Jogger, City Slickers II: The Legend of Curly's Gold (also known as City Slickers: The Legend of Curly's Gold and City Slickers II), Sony Pictures Releasing, 1994.

Park nanny, Losing Isaiah, Paramount, 1995.

White House staffer Maria, The American President, Columbia, 1995.

Nurse, Dracula: Dead and Loving It (also known as Dracula mort et heureux de l'etre), Columbia, 1995.

Holiday Inn salesgirl, Girl in the Cadillac, Columbia TriStar Home Video, 1995.

Rose, Fathers' Day, Warner Bros., 1997.

Madeleine, 35 Miles from Normal, 1997.

Lily, A Midsummer Night's Rave, Velocity Home Entertainment, 2002.

(As Jennifer Crystal Foley) Voice, The Shape of Things (also known as Fausses apparences), Focus Features, 2003.

They Would Love You in France, 2003.

Television Appearances; Series:

Annie Carver, Sessions, HBO, 1991.

(As Jennifer Crystal Foley) Christie Parker, Once and Again, ABC, 2000-2001.

Television Appearances; Movies:

Shana Fleiss, The Making of a Hollywood Madam (also known as The Good Doctor: The Paul Fleiss Story), CBS, 1996.

Hank's secretary, Don King: Only in America, HBO, 1997.

(As Jennifer Crystal Foley) Pat Maris, 61* (also known as Home Run Race and 61), HBO, 2001.

Television Appearances; Specials:

Billy Crystal: Midnight Train to Moscow, HBO, 1989.

Television Appearances; Episodic:

Deborah, "Radio Daze," Beverly Hills, 90210, Fox, 1993.

Deborah, "Strangers in the Night," Beverly Hills, 90210, Fox, 1993.

Deborah, "Otherwise Engaged," Beverly Hills, 90210, Fox, 1993.

Reba "Home," ER, NBC, 1995.

Nurse Larlee, "R & R," Space: Above and Beyond, Fox, 1995.

Marlene Blevins, "All's Well that Ends Well," NYPD Blue, ABC, 1997.

Female customer, "A Girl's Gotta Live in the Real World," Jenny, NBC, 1997.

Kathy, "Caroline and the Used Car Salesman," Caroline in the City (also known as Caroline), NBC, 1997.

Cynthia, "End of an Eros," Cupid, ABC, 1998.

Lisa Levine, "What Arliss Hath Joined Together," Arli$$, 1998.

The Rosie O'Donnell Show, syndicated, 2001.

(As Jennifer Crystal Foley) Kelly Goss, "M. Premie Unplugged," The Practice, ABC, 2002.

(As Foley) Gail, "Hello, I Love You," Touched by an Angel, CBS, 2002.

(As Foley) Krista, "The Wedding Planner," Providence, NBC, 2002.

The Oprah Winfrey Show (also known as Oprah), syndicated, 2004.

Stage Appearances:

Julie, D Girl, Century City Playhouse, Los Angeles, 1997.
